GB/T 10417-2008
AbolishedSpecifications for steel-bonded tungsten carbides and determination of its transverse rupture strength, impact toughness and hardness
碳化钨钢结硬质合金技术条件及其力学性能的测试方法
Application Summary AI generated
This standard specifies the technical requirements, classification, and testing methods for steel-bonded tungsten carbides, including procedures for measuring transverse rupture strength, impact toughness, and hardness. It is applied in the metallurgy and tooling industries for quality control and material selection of wear-resistant components such as dies, punches, and mining tools. The standard ensures consistent performance evaluation in manufacturing and procurement contexts where these composite materials are used.
